Thinking about your cooking style and experience level ensures you pick a set that fits your needs without overspending or sacrificing functionality.Blade Material and Construction
High-quality blade materials like high carbon stainless steel tend to offer better edge retention and corrosion resistance. Forged blades are usually stronger and more durable than stamped ones, making them a worthwhile investment for regular cooks. Cheaper sets often use lower-grade steel or stamped blades, which may require more frequent sharpening and can feel less sturdy. Prioritizing blade quality ensures your knives stay sharp longer and perform well across different tasks.
Number and Variety of Knives
Consider how many and which types of knives are included. A well-rounded set typically features a chef’s knife, paring knife, bread knife, and utility knife at minimum. More extensive sets may add specialized blades like fillet or cleaver knives, which are useful for specific tasks. However, larger sets tend to be more expensive and can include knives you may never use. Tailor your choice to your cooking style—if you only need basic tools, a smaller, focused set might be best.
Blade Sharpness and Maintenance
Sharpness is vital for safe and effective cutting. Sets with built-in sharpeners or easy-to-sharpen blades reduce downtime and frustration. Look for knife steels that can be easily maintained with regular honing and sharpening. Avoid sets with blades that are difficult to sharpen or require professional servicing, which can add to long-term costs. Investing in a set with good edge retention can save money and keep your knives performing well for years.
Handle Comfort and Ergonomics
Comfortable, ergonomically designed handles reduce fatigue during extended use and improve control. Materials vary from plastic and rubber to wood, each with pros and cons—rubber handles offer non-slip grip, while wood provides a classic feel but may require more maintenance. Testing the handle design before purchase can prevent discomfort and ensure a secure grip. This factor is especially important if you cook frequently or prefer precise control.
Additional Features and Storage Options
Many knife sets come with storage blocks, magnetic strips, or cases. While blocks help keep knives organized and protected, they can take up counter space and may be difficult to clean. Magnetic strips save space and provide easy access but require proper installation and care to prevent damage. Built-in sharpeners add convenience but can complicate cleaning or increase the price. Choose a set that matches your kitchen space and maintenance preferences.

How often should I sharpen my knives?
The frequency of sharpening depends on usage and blade quality. Generally, high-quality knives can go several months without sharpening if maintained properly, but honing regularly with a steel can help maintain the edge. When you notice a decline in cutting performance or require more force, it’s time to sharpen or have them professionally serviced. Regular sharpening extends the lifespan of your knives and keeps them performing at their best.
Can I use these knife sets for professional cooking?
Most home-oriented knife sets are suitable for serious cooks, but professional chefs often prefer custom or higher-end forged knives with premium steels. For professional use, look for sets with balanced weight, excellent edge retention, and comfortable handles designed for extensive use. If you cook professionally or frequently prep large quantities, investing in individual high-end knives may offer better long-term value than a standard set.
